首页 > 解决方案 > JQuery - 单击时添加和删除类

问题描述

$('.toggle-button').on('click', function() {
    $('body').addClass('changeCursor');
  });

  $('.toggle-button.toggle-active').on('click', function() {
    $('body').removeClass('changeCursor');
  });

嘿伙计们,我需要在 body 上添加类,并且在再次单击它时应该删除它。我在上面附上了我的代码。但它不起作用,请通过更清晰。谢谢 :)

标签: javascriptjqueryhtmlcss

解决方案


您可以使用 toggleClass()

例子:

$('.toggle-button').on('click', function() {
    $('body').toggleClass('changeCursor');
});

文档:http ://api.jquery.com/toggle/


推荐阅读